The Enate Merlot-Merlot is, as the name suggests, a 100% Merlot wine. The grapes come from the finest plots at Enate and are hand-picked and destemmed. The wine has been aged for 16 months in French oak. The Enate Merlot-Merlot is very concentrated and powerful, with a complex panorama of blackberry, coffee, and chocolate. It has a lot of body and a very long and impressive finish. A perfect wine with lamb and game, heavy pork and beef dishes, beef in sauce, grilled meats, and strong cheeses. This Enate is the Pomerol of Somontano.

Enate is a modern Bodega from Somontano in northern Spain. Enate is located in the village of Salas Bajas, in Somontano, which is located in the northeast of Spain, a good distance from the coast. The leafy landscape can be quite rough, which fully confirms the name Somontano - under the mountains. The local wine growers have had to lobby for a long time to obtain their DO status, but they did manage in the end. Since then, Somontano has been a big name in Spanish wine growing. So enate wines come from a good family. The area where the grape for the Enate wine is grown is characterized by above average rainfall and an abundance of rivers and streams. All that water is good for the soil, which consists largely of clay and sandstone. The nearby Pyrenees give the weather a certain capriciousness. At night it is surprisingly cold, while the sun can scorch in the afternoon. Those 2 extremes give the grapes used for the Enate wine a good balance of acids and sugars.

Despite the relatively young age of this bodega, founded in 1991, it is already one of the most prestigious wineries in Spain. In addition to the quality of the wines, Enate stands out for its sampling. Spanjes' best contemporary visual artists make the labels. ENATE's mission is to make high-quality and premium wines from the best grapes of Somontano, with respect for the ancient local traditions and using the latest technology.

This company with 500 ha of vineyards has a clear philosophy: the Nozaleda family wants to make the best wines from the Denominación Somontano. Oenologist Jesús Artajona translates this philosophy into wine. Bodega Enate concentrates on the international grape varieties Merlot, Cabernet and Chardonnay and the Spanish royal grape Tempranillo. The company makes 85% red wine, 10% white wine and 5% rosé. The vineyards are located at the foot of the Pyrenees at an altitude of 550-600 m above sea level. The climate is Atlantic. This means high temperatures during the day (34-35 ° C) and strong cooling at night (17-18 ° C), ideal for the growth of the grapes.

The establishment of the winery also went its own way: the main building is multifunctional and was designed with the aim of uniting spectacular architecture with the wine world. This gives Enate a lot of attention from mountain hikers and curious wine lovers. The objective of bringing art and wine together is reflected in the labels of the bottles. It shows works of art from the Spanish art avant-garde (Antonio Saura, Eduardo Chillida, Antoni Tàpies and many others). The collection of own labels is exhibited in the winery's own gallery.
